#24f244 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#24f244 is composed of 14.1% red, 94.9%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.9%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 129.3 degrees, a saturation of 88.8% and a lightness of 54.5%. #24f244 color hex could be obtained by blending #48ff88 with #00e500.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

#24f244 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#24f244 has RGB values of R:36, G:242,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.72,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 2421316.

Shades and Tints of #24f244
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000301 is the darkest color, while #f0fef2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#24f244
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#869088 is the less saturated color, while #1bfb3e is the most saturated one.
